I used the Xiaomi Redmi Note 3 for over 2 years and here’s my honest opinion. When it launched, it was a game-changer in the budget segment, but with time, its limitations became more visible.
-
?? Sound Reception:
Sound quality is decent for calls and basic music listening. However, the loudspeaker isn’t very powerful and gets distorted at high volumes.
?? User Friendly:
MIUI is easy to use and offers a clean interface, but it often comes with bloatware and occasional lags, especially after updates.
?? Style & Design:
Metal body gives a premium look. Slim and feels good in hand. Fingerprint sensor at the back was a bonus at that time and worked well.
?? Other Features:
Fingerprint unlock works fast
Dual SIM with microSD support
IR Blaster is useful
But… it lacks USB Type-C, fast charging is slow by today’s standards.

? Pros:
Great value when it launched
Decent battery backup
Premium metal body
Good display brightness
? Cons:
Lags in performance over time
Not good for heavy gaming
Camera is average, especially in low light
No software updates anymore
-
?? Final Verdict:
If you’re still using it in 2025, its time to upgrade. It was one of the best in its time, but now it struggles to keep up. Still, for the price back then, it was worth it.
